Postal Search Ajax API 構築キット
Postal Search Ajax API 構築キットは、あなたの WEB サーバに Postal Search Ajax API の機能を構築するためのパッケージ です。本 API 構築キットを使うと、あなたの WEB サーバに Postal Search APIs & Solutions のサーバとは完全に独立した形で Postal Search Ajax API の環境を構築でき、あなたの WEB サーバのみで独立して運用できるようになります。
本 API 構築キットは Perl や PHP といった CGI プログラムを必要としません。本 API 構築キットの プログラムやデータベースは、すべて JavaScript で構成 しています。ですので、FTP を使ってファイルをアップロードでき、JavaScript でプログラミングができる方なら、以下の手順にしたがって簡単に導入できるようになっています。
郵便番号と住所のデータベースは、あなたの WEB サーバで管理するため、あなたの WEB サーバにデータを格納し、その最新データを維持する必要があります。最新のデータベースは、本サイトで定期的に公開していますので、必要に応じてダウンロードして最新データに差し替えてください。
1. API 構築キットをダウンロードする
はじめに Postal Search Ajax API 構築キットをダウンロード します。
これ以降、ダウンロードした API 構築キットのファイル名を postal-20070906.zip として説明します。 ファイル名の内 20070906 の部分は API 構築キットをリリースした日付を表しています。 この日付を置き換えて読み進めてください。
2. API 構築キットを解凍する
次に、ダウンロードしたファイルを解凍します。ファイルを解凍すると、次のとおりファイルが展開されますので、その内容を確認してください。
ファイル構成:postal-20070906/ +-- js/ +-- postalua.js +-- lookup/ +-- ###.js +-- coder/ +-- ###.js +-- AGREEMENT.txt +-- LICENSE.txt +-- jQuery-LICENSE.txt +-- form1.html +-- form2.html
- js / postalua.js
-
Postal Search Ajax API の JavaScript ファイルです。 このファイルには jQuery という JavaScript Library とそのプラグインも含まれます。
- lookup / ###.js
- coder / ###.js
-
郵便番号と住所を格納したデータベースファイルです。合計 1,994 の JavaScript ファイルから成り立ちます。
- AGREEMENT.txt
-
Postal Search APIs & Solutions の利用規約を表したテキストファイルです。
- LICENSE.txt
- jQuery-LICENSE.txt
-
Postal Search Ajax API と jQuery のライセンスを表したテキストファイルです。
- form1.html
- form2.html
-
Postal Search Ajax API を使った送信フォームのサンプルファイルです。 一般的な JavaScript 構文を使ったものと jQuery を使ったものの 2通りが含まれます。
ディレクトリ名の内 20070906 の部分は API 構築キットをリリースした日付を表しています。 この日付を置き換えて読み進めてください。
3. API 構築キットをアップロードする
上記のディレクトリ名を postal-20070906 から postal に変更し、このディレクトリをそのまま丸ごと WEB サーバにアップロードします。
これ以降、アップロードしたディレクトリは http://example.com/postal/ の URL でアクセスできるものとして説明します。 あなたがアップロードした WEB サーバのドメイン名とディレクトリに置き換えて読み進めてください。
4. API 構築キットを利用する
Postal Search Ajax API を使う HTML ページに、次の script タグを貼り付けます。
貼り付けコード:<script type="text/javascript" src="/postal/js/postalua.js"></script> <script type="text/javascript"><!-- Postal.url = '/postal'; --></script>
1行目の script タグの src 属性には Postal Search Ajax API の JavaScript ファイルを指定します。例では /postal/js/postalua.js としています。
3行目の Postal.url には API 構築キットをアップロードしたディレクトリを指定します。このとき末尾の / は不要です。例では /postal としています。
5. API 構築キットを活用する
以上で Postal Search Ajax API を利用する準備が整いました。API の使い方は Postal Search Ajax API ドキュメント をご覧ください。